Eddie Griffin's NBA Journey: Legacy & Impact?

Eddie Griffin was an American professional basketball player who entered the NBA as a highly regarded prospect. Drafted 7th overall by the Houston Rockets in the 2001 NBA Draft, Griffin showcased versatility as a forward-center before his career was tragically cut short by a fatal vehicle crash in 2007. Across parts of six NBA seasons, Eddie Griffin played for the Houston Rockets, New Jersey Nets, and Minnesota Timberwolves, leaving behind a memory of potential and what-ifs for basketball fans.

4. Playing style & skills

Griffin was known for his length, movement skills, and shot-blocking instincts. Eddie Griffin’s ability to switch onto smaller players, protect the rim, and finish above the rim gave teams a versatile option at the forward/center position. While consistency varied, the talents of Eddie Griffin remained a talking point.
